Home / Tools / GitHub Copilot

extensionPaid

GitHub Copilot

بهترین گزینه برای توسعه‌دهندگانی که می‌خواهند پیشنهادهای سریع کد inline در ویرایشگر موجودشان بدون تغییر گردش کار داشته باشند.

PricingIndividual ماهی ۱۰ دلار / Business ماهی ۱۹ دلار
Websitegithub.com/features/copilot

Features

  • +پیشنهادهای کد inline بلادرنگ هنگام تایپ
  • +Copilot Chat برای سؤالات زبان طبیعی در ویرایشگر
  • +کار در VS Code، JetBrains، Neovim و موارد بیشتر
  • +زمینه از فایل‌های باز و فضای کاری
  • +توضیح کد و تولید مستندات
  • +تولید تست از کد موجود
  • +یکپارچه‌سازی CLI برای دستورات ترمینال
  • +ویژگی‌های Enterprise با کنترل‌های سیاست سازمانی

Pros

  • +کم‌اصطکاک‌ترین ابزار هوش مصنوعی برای پذیرش چون به عنوان یک افزونه اجرا می‌شود
  • +سرعت و دقت عالی تکمیل خودکار inline
  • +پشتیبانی گسترده از ویرایشگر در VS Code، JetBrains، Neovim
  • +پشتیبانی‌شده توسط GitHub با آگاهی عمیق از مخزن
  • +با بزرگترین پایگاه کاربری هر ابزار برنامه‌نویسی هوش مصنوعی به خوبی تثبیت شده

Cons

  • قابلیت‌های ایجنتی محدود در مقایسه با Claude Code یا Cursor Composer
  • زمینه چت محدودتر از ابزارهایی با نمایه‌سازی کامل کدبیس است
  • بدون سطح رایگان برای توسعه‌دهندگان فردی
  • پیشنهادها می‌توانند در کدبیس‌های پیچیده تکراری یا نادرست باشند

GitHub Copilot پرکاربردترین ابزار برنامه‌نویسی هوش مصنوعی است. به عنوان یک افزونه در ویرایشگر موجود شما اجرا می‌شود و پیشنهادهای کد بلادرنگ هنگام تایپ ارائه می‌دهد. یک کامنت می‌نویسید که توضیح می‌دهد چه می‌خواهید، شروع به تایپ یک تابع می‌کنید یا فقط به کدنویسی ادامه می‌دهید، و Copilot تکمیل‌هایی را بر اساس زمینه شما پیشنهاد می‌کند.

Copilot همچنین یک ویژگی چت برای پرسیدن سؤال درباره کد شما، تولید تست، توضیح توابع پیچیده و دریافت کمک در اشکال‌زدایی دارد. با همه زبان‌های برنامه‌نویسی اصلی کار می‌کند و با VS Code، JetBrains IDEs، Neovim و GitHub CLI یکپارچه می‌شود.

ویژگی‌های کلیدی

ارزش اصلی Copilot سرعت است. پیشنهادهای inline آن با حداقل تأخیر هنگام تایپ ظاهر می‌شوند و باعث می‌شود مثل یک امتداد طبیعی جریان کدنویسی احساس شود. از الگوهای فایل‌های باز و فضای کاری شما یاد می‌گیرد تا تکمیل‌های مرتبط با زمینه ارائه دهد.

رابط چت به شما اجازه می‌دهد سؤال درباره کدبیس بپرسید، مستندات تولید کنید، تست از کد موجود ایجاد کنید و توضیح منطق پیچیده دریافت کنید. طرح‌های Enterprise ویژگی‌هایی مانند کنترل‌های سیاست سازمانی، گزارش‌های حسابرسی و جبران IP اضافه می‌کنند.

چه کسانی باید از GitHub Copilot استفاده کنند؟

GitHub Copilot انتخاب درستی برای توسعه‌دهندگان و تیم‌هایی است که می‌خواهند هوش مصنوعی را با حداقل اختلال به گردش کار خود اضافه کنند. اگر از ویرایشگر فعلی خود راضی هستید و فقط می‌خواهید تکمیل خودکار هوشمندتر و یک پنل چت داشته باشید، Copilot آن را بدون نیاز به تغییر ابزارها یا عادات ارائه می‌دهد. به‌خصوص برای تیم‌هایی که قبلاً از GitHub استفاده می‌کنند عالی است.

آیا GitHub Copilot ارزش ۱۰ دلار در ماه را دارد؟+
برای اکثر توسعه‌دهندگان حرفه‌ای، بله. زمان صرفه‌جویی‌شده در کد boilerplate، نوشتن تست و مستندات معمولاً ظرف چند روز اول استفاده به خودی خود جبران می‌شود. بازگشت سرمایه برای توسعه‌دهندگانی که کد تکراری زیادی می‌نویسند یا در چندین زبان کار می‌کنند بیشترین است.
آیا GitHub Copilot با JetBrains IDEs کار می‌کند؟+
بله. GitHub Copilot افزونه‌های رسمی برای IntelliJ IDEA، PyCharm، WebStorm و سایر JetBrains IDEs دارد. تجربه مشابه VS Code با پیشنهادهای inline و چت است.
Copilot حریم خصوصی کد را چگونه مدیریت می‌کند؟+
طرح‌های Copilot Business و Enterprise از کد شما برای آموزش مدل استفاده نمی‌کنند. طرح‌های فردی یک تنظیم opt-out دارند. قطعه‌های کد برای پردازش به سرورهای GitHub ارسال می‌شوند اما فراتر از جلسه ذخیره نمی‌شوند.
آیا GitHub Copilot می‌تواند ویرایش چندفایلی انجام دهد؟+
قابلیت‌های ایجنتی Copilot در حال رشد هستند اما هنوز در مقایسه با ابزارهای اختصاصی مانند Claude Code محدود است. می‌تواند تغییرات را در فایل‌ها در چت پیشنهاد دهد، اما به‌طور مستقل چندین فایل را ویرایش نمی‌کند، تست‌ها را اجرا نمی‌کند و به روشی که یک ابزار ایجنتی واقعی انجام می‌دهد تکرار نمی‌کند.

Comparisons

Claude Code vs GitHub Copilot

Master Claude Code in days, not months

37 hands-on lessons from beginner to CI/CD automation. Module 1 is free.

START FREE →
← ALL TOOLS